A joint collaboration between the XM forum and the BXClub has been proposed for the weekend of the 25/26 th of May. Subject to confirmation from Barry Annels. Any Citroen models welcomed and in particular the hydropneumatic variants. The idea is for people to tinker and work on their cars and to assist with teaching and imparting their knowledge/skills to those still learning. The BXClub held a similar event in Ludlow last year and it was a resounding success, with a good time had by all.

Further details to be announced, once definite confirmation has been received by Barry.
